LEES, Cooper wrote: > > Since I know (via backing up my sharetab) what shares I need to > have (all nfs share - no cifs on this 4500 - YAY) and have organised > downtime for this server, would it be easier for me to go to Solaris > 10u6 (or opensolaris) by just installing from scratch and re-importing > the ZPOOL
If you have spare machine (or spare disk at least) I'd recommend you do that: install u6 or opensolaris to another disk/machine and import data zpool afterwards. > (of course after exporting it before installing the 'new' os) rather > then using luupdate. Then appropriately upgrading the pool to the > version to match the OS I choose. I suggest you defer zpool and zfs version upgrade for later. That way if something goes horribly wrong with the new OS you can still use your old OS to access that zpool. Regards, Fajar
